I have played Disney Infinity on Wii U, since launch day, only playing co op. At launch the only option for player 2 was the Wii remote and nunchuk. This wasn't a problem at all, but since then there has been an update to allow player 2 to use the Pro Controller and use the same control scheme as player 1.
